Srinagar: The Jammu and Kashmir government on Tuesday appointmented retired IAS officer, B R Sharma as Chairman of the J&K Public Service Commission. As per an order issued by Secretary General Administration Department, Farooq Ahmad Lone, Sharma shall hold the position till he attains the age of 62 years. Washington: The United States Treasury department said it plans to borrow USD 2.9 trillion during the April-June quarter to deal with the coronavirus pandemic.
